目的:探讨心跳骤停和心肺复苏过程中血管活性物质水平的变化。方法:对28例心跳骤停和心肺复苏病人,以及18例危重病人用放免的方法测定其血清前列环素(PGI_2)、血栓素(TXA_2)、内皮素(ET)和心钠素(ANP)水平,并进行对照研究。结果:随着自主循环的建立,ET和ANP水平明显降低,而PGI_2和TXA_2水平增高,其中PGI_2/TXA_2比例增高更为显著。危重病人组随着病情的恢复和稳定也出现上述变化。危重病人和心跳骤停病人组比较,其PGI_2和TXA_2水平高于心跳骤停组,而ET和ANP水平低于心跳骤停组。结论:心跳骤停和心肺复苏过程中体内血管活性物质水平发生显著变化。其中心钠素和内皮素水平的增高可能是预后不良的指标,而PGI_2/TXA_2比例增高有利于复苏成功。
Objective: To investigate the changes of vasoactive substances in cardiac arrest and cardiopulmonary resuscitation. Methods: Serum PGI2, TXA2, ET and ANP were measured in 28 patients with cardiac arrest and cardiopulmonary resuscitation, and 18 critically ill patients by radioimmunoassay. Level, and control study. Results: With the establishment of spontaneous circulation, the levels of ET and ANP decreased significantly while the levels of PGI_2 and TXA_2 increased. The proportion of PGI_2 / TXA_2 increased more significantly. Critically ill patients with the recovery and stability of the disease also appeared in the above changes. The patients with critical illness and patients with cardiac arrest had higher levels of PGI_2 and TXA_2 than those with cardiac arrest and ET and ANP levels were lower than those with cardiac arrest. CONCLUSIONS: There is a significant change in the levels of vasoactive substances in the body during cardiac arrest and cardiopulmonary resuscitation. The increase of atrial natriuretic peptide and endothelin levels may be an indicator of poor prognosis, and the higher proportion of PGI_2 / TXA_2 is beneficial to the success of resuscitation.
